What Makes a Wireless Charger Fast Charging for Galaxy S20?

To determine what makes a wireless charger fast charging for the Galaxy S20, several key features and specifications must be considered.

  • Qi Compatibility: The Galaxy S20 is built to work with Qi wireless charging standards, making it essential for any wireless charger to support this technology to ensure optimal performance.
  • Output Power: Fast wireless charging typically requires an output of 10W or higher; therefore, chargers specifically designed for fast charging can significantly reduce charging time compared to standard 5W chargers.
  • Cooling Technology: Advanced cooling features in wireless chargers help maintain optimal temperatures during charging, preventing overheating and ensuring efficient power transfer, which is essential for fast charging.
  • Design and Placement: Chargers that offer a secure and stable design allow for optimal alignment between the phone and charger, reducing energy loss and improving charging speed.
  • Compatibility with Fast Charging Adapters: Using a fast charging adapter that meets the requirements of the wireless charger can enhance the charging speed, as the charger can draw the necessary power to deliver fast charging capabilities.

Qi compatibility ensures that the charger can communicate effectively with the Galaxy S20, allowing it to initiate fast charging protocols. This is crucial because not all wireless chargers are compatible with every device’s charging standards, and using an incompatible charger may result in slower charging speeds.

The output power is a significant factor in the charging speed; chargers that provide at least 10W can charge the Galaxy S20 faster than those limited to 5W. Fast wireless chargers designed for the Galaxy S20 often feature this higher output to maximize efficiency.

Cooling technology is vital because wireless charging generates heat, which can impede performance. Chargers that incorporate fan systems or heat-dissipating materials help maintain a cooler environment, facilitating faster and safer charging.

The design and placement of the charger play a critical role in ensuring the phone is properly aligned with the charging coil, which minimizes energy loss. A misaligned phone can lead to slower charging speeds, so a charger that features guides or a non-slip surface can enhance this aspect.

Lastly, using a fast charging adapter is essential because many wireless chargers require a specific power input to achieve their maximum charging speed. A compatible adapter ensures that the charger receives adequate power to function at its best, thus providing fast charging for the Galaxy S20.

What Are the Common Pros and Cons of Using Wireless Chargers for Galaxy S20?

Pros Cons
Convenient and easy to use – Simply place your Galaxy S20 on the charger without plugging in cables. Slower charging speeds – Typically charges slower than wired options, which may affect urgent charging needs.
Reduces wear on charging ports – Minimizes physical wear and tear on the device’s charging port. Higher cost – Generally more expensive compared to traditional wired chargers.
Compatible with multiple devices – Can charge various Qi-enabled devices, not just the Galaxy S20. Heat generation – May generate more heat, which can affect battery health over time.
Includes safety features – Many models have overcharge protection and foreign object detection for added safety. Battery lifespan impact – Wireless charging may contribute to slightly reduced battery lifespan compared to wired charging.
